file-type

Prysm Eth2客户端DAppNode软件包:信标链与验证器

ZIP文件

下载需积分: 5 | 46KB | 更新于2025-03-15 | 124 浏览量 | 5 评论 | 0 下载量 举报 收藏
download 立即下载
标题中提到的知识点主要有以下几个: 1. DAppNodePackage:DAppNode是一种允许用户在自己的设备上直接运行去中心化应用程序(DApp)的服务。DAppNodePackage则是一套软件包,方便用户在DAppNode上部署和管理这些DApp。 2. Prysm:Prysm是一个开源项目,它实现了以太坊2.0升级的一部分,即Serenity协议。这个协议的核心是转向权益证明(Proof of Stake,PoS)机制,这是以太坊打算采用的新共识算法,与目前的权益证明机制(Proof of Work,PoW)不同,PoS被认为更节能、更安全。 3. Pyrmont testnet:Pyrmont是ETH2.0的一个测试网络。测试网络通常用于开发者测试新功能和网络升级,让社区成员和开发者可以在主网之前先行体验新特性和升级。 4. Beacon and Validator:Beacon链是ETH2.0协议中的核心部分,负责协调网络中的验证者节点。验证者节点则是运行在用户硬件上的特定软件,负责验证网络交易和区块,以确保网络的安全性和稳定。 描述部分的知识点: 1. Go实现:Go语言(也称为Golang)是一种开源编程语言,它具有简单、高效、快速的特点。ETH2.0的Prysm客户端就是使用Go语言开发的。 2. Prysmatic Labs:Prysmatic Labs是以太坊2.0的开发团队,负责开发Prysm客户端。它们是Prysm客户端背后的开源开发者社区。 3. Grafana:Grafana是一个开源的数据可视化和监控解决方案,它可以将收集到的数据通过图形化的方式展示,从而帮助用户更好地理解数据。在这个上下文中,Grafana仪表板可能被用于展示网络性能、节点状态等信息。 标签中的"Dockerfile"的知识点: 1. Dockerfile:Dockerfile是一个文本文件,包含了用户可以在命令行上调用的所有命令,以此来创建一个Docker镜像。Docker镜像则是一个轻量级、可执行的独立软件包,包含运行应用程序所需的一切:代码、运行时、库、环境变量和配置文件。Dockerfile是使用Docker构建镜像时必须的一个组件。 压缩包子文件的文件名称列表中的"DAppNodePackage-prysm-pyrmont-master"的知识点: 1. Master:在版本控制术语中,"master"通常指的是主分支,也即是一般开发和部署的主要代码分支。 综上所述,这份DAppNode软件包主要是提供了一套工具集,使得用户能够轻松地在自己的设备上通过DAppNode服务部署Prysm软件,进而连接到以太坊2.0的Pyrmont测试网络。这一过程包括了运行一个Beacon节点和一个或多个验证者节点,以参与到这个测试网络的维护中。其中使用的工具是基于Go语言开发的,可以预期运行DAppNodePackage-prysm-pyrmont-master将为用户提供一个预先配置好的、稳定和易于管理的以太坊2.0客户端环境,而且可能还集成了Grafana仪表板,以便于监控节点的状态和性能。此外,这个软件包是通过Dockerfile构建Docker镜像进行部署的,这也是现代应用程序部署的一种常见做法,以确保跨平台的一致性和易用性。

相关推荐

资源评论
用户头像
UEgood雪姐姐
2025.06.18
"Prysm软件包为以太坊2.0信标链和验证器提供强力支持,易于部署和管理。"
用户头像
柔粟
2025.05.05
"对于想要体验最新以太坊2.0技术的用户来说,Prysm是一个优秀的起点。"👎
用户头像
李多田
2025.05.02
"专为以太坊2.0设计,Prysm软件包包含必要的二进制文件,方便开发者测试和部署。"
用户头像
实在想不出来了
2025.04.16
"Prysm DAppNodePackage让pyrmont测试网的搭建变得简单,推动以太坊2.0的开发进程。"
用户头像
林书尼
2025.01.18
"结合Grafana仪表板,Prysm DAppNodePackage为用户提供了监控以太坊2.0信标节点的强力工具。"